First up is “Magic Brownies” which has a really intriguing color combination.  Unfortunately, it’s just not my cup of tea, although I do like the concept.  It has a lighter chocolate brown base with a strong green shimmer.  It comes off a little bit frosty and just doesn’t suit my skin tone well but the formula was nice and really easy to work with.  It’s opaque in 2 coats.  I did 3 coats here for good measure.

“Shooby Doo” has bright turquoise and holographic silver glitter in a clear base.  This one is really pretty and sparkly.  Nice formula and nice glitter pickup.  The bar glitter laid really nice and flat as well!  This one was my favorite of the three!  This is 2 coats over China Glaze “First Mate.”

“Tear Dust” has a sheer gray base with bright turquoise and white glitter and holographic shimmer.  This one would have been my favorite but it was near impossible to get the white glitter out.  It all sunk to the bottom.  I left it upside down for a few minutes and I was able to get a few pieces but not many.  The turquoise glitter on the other hand was a breeze to pickup.  This is 2 coats over China Glaze “Recycle.”
